Output 577414e3ac3703443cbcbe016e8a648f75f38fc362c0a12bad514f016507e8ae:40

value
1066820
script pubkey
OP_HASH160 OP_PUSHBYTES_20 77775a6ba5065cb55bd8adcaf1e34a65d26796af OP_EQUAL
address
3CahKBFqgBWJum7JpqfqjSJwrbznpoi9X8
transaction
577414e3ac3703443cbcbe016e8a648f75f38fc362c0a12bad514f016507e8ae
spent
true